An efficient copper(I)-catalyzed enyne oxidation/cyclopropanation for the modular synthesis of cyclopropane derivatives is described, which represents first non-noble metal-catalyzed enynes by in situ generated α-oxo copper carbenes. This protocol allows assembly valuable cyclopropane-γ-lactams generally good to excellent yields with diastereoselectivity. More significantly, enantioselective version has been disclosed chiral catalysts.

Described herein is an efficient copper-catalyzed tandem alkyne indolylcupration-initiated 1,2-indole migration/6π-electrocyclic reaction of allene-ynamides with indoles by the in situ-generated metal carbenes. This method allows synthesis valuable indole-fused spirobenzo[f]indole-cyclohexanes high regio- and stereoselectivity. In addition, this affords rapid access to functionalized absence a presumable 5-exo-dig cyclization/Friedel–Crafts alkylation via copper-containing all-carbon 1,4-dipoles.
